Transaction bd0417a020b3e33f0547823804cbd336485918af34931384cee15a8d0fc24649
1 Input
2 Outputs
- bd0417a020b3e33f0547823804cbd336485918af34931384cee15a8d0fc24649:0
- bd0417a020b3e33f0547823804cbd336485918af34931384cee15a8d0fc24649:1
value 795817897
address 1AoVH1P8WLU61mYddCsipftyTDLwzrWSPu
value 23439569
address 1MJ333zhkCf5pptJPf5gRSxTmKVrmC2s19